About This Course
The ICTQual Level 3 Award in Sports First Aid Training is designed to develop the skills and confidence required to respond effectively to injuries and medical emergencies occurring in sports and physical activity settings. It focuses on immediate care, injury assessment, and emergency intervention techniques relevant to athletes and active individuals.
Understanding roles and responsibilities of a sports first aider
Assessing incidents in sports environments safely
Managing sports-related injuries and trauma
Performing CPR and using AED in emergencies
Recognising and responding to medical conditions in athletes
Applying risk assessment and prevention strategies
What You'll Learn
This course develops practical competence in responding to sports-related emergencies and delivering immediate care in athletic settings.
Understand principles of sports first aid and duty of care
Assess and manage sports injuries safely and effectively
Perform CPR and operate an AED in emergencies
Treat fractures, sprains, strains, and soft tissue injuries
Respond to heat exhaustion, dehydration, and collapse
Apply emergency communication and casualty management techniques

Course Requirements
This is an entry-level sports first aid qualification; however, learners should be able to participate in practical activities and understand basic instructions.
Minimum age of 16 years recommended
Basic literacy and communication skills required
Assessments
Learners are assessed through practical demonstrations and theoretical knowledge evaluations to ensure competency in sports first aid response.
Practical skills assessment in simulated emergencies
Written or multiple-choice knowledge assessment
Scenario-based evaluation of sports injury response
Ongoing trainer observation during practical sessions
